Abram Creek is a great run that offers amazing scenery of woods, coal mines, and railroad tracks. The stream flows quickly and requires tight maneuvering through many boulder filled rapids. After the first mile the creek flows slower for a small section then it picks back up to class 2 and class 3. There are some nice campgrounds along the creek to make it a 2 day trip.
